The Problem / The Challenge

The deployment of private 5G networks presents unique challenges that require a comprehensive approach to testing. Unlike traditional networks, private 5G networks are tailored to specific enterprise needs, which can lead to complexities in performance and interoperability. Operators often face difficulties in ensuring that these networks meet stringent quality standards while also delivering the expected user experience.

One of the primary challenges is the lack of standardized testing protocols for private 5G networks. Many organizations are still relying on outdated methodologies that do not account for the unique characteristics of 5G technology. This can result in inadequate testing, leading to issues such as latency, connectivity drops, and overall network inefficiency. Without a clear understanding of how to effectively test these networks, operators risk deploying systems that fail to meet user expectations.

Furthermore, the rapid pace of technological advancement in 5G means that operators must continuously adapt their testing strategies. The introduction of new features, such as network slicing and edge computing, adds layers of complexity that traditional testing methods cannot adequately address. This dynamic environment requires a proactive approach to testing, where operators can quickly identify and resolve issues before they impact end-users.

Lastly, the pressure to deliver high-quality services while managing costs can lead to compromises in testing. Operators may be tempted to cut corners, resulting in insufficient testing that ultimately jeopardizes network performance. The Approach / What Good Looks Like

To navigate the complexities of 5G network testing, operators need a structured approach that encompasses comprehensive testing methodologies and independent assurance. Here’s what good looks like:

Comprehensive Testing Framework

A robust testing framework should include a variety of testing types, such as functional testing, performance testing, and security testing. Each of these areas plays a critical role in ensuring that the network operates as intended. For instance, functional testing verifies that all features work correctly, while performance testing assesses the network’s ability to handle expected loads. Security testing is equally important, as it identifies vulnerabilities that could be exploited by malicious actors.

Real-World Scenarios

Testing should not be limited to lab environments; it must also encompass real-world scenarios. This means simulating actual user behavior and network conditions to understand how the network performs under stress. By employing techniques such as load testing and stress testing, operators can gain insights into potential bottlenecks and areas for improvement. This real-world approach ensures that the network is resilient and capable of delivering a seamless user experience.

Continuous Monitoring and Feedback Loops

The testing process should not end with deployment. Continuous monitoring is essential for identifying issues that may arise post-launch. Implementing feedback loops allows operators to gather data on network performance and user experience, enabling them to make informed decisions about necessary adjustments. This iterative process ensures that the network remains optimized over time, adapting to changing user needs and technological advancements.
